Motorists want protruding manhole in Srinivasapuram fixed

Motorists frequenting Srinivasapuram Main Road in Srinivasapuram, off East Coast Road, have requested the Chennai Metropolitan Water Supply and Sewerage Board (CMWSSB) and Greater Chennai Corporation (GCC) to attend to a problem that can be solved only through a joint action by these two government agencies.

The want a protruding manhole to be brought on the same level as the road.

To avoid hitting the protruding manhole, many motorists swerve left and right, throwing those coming behind them, and others travelling in the opposite direction in a spot of trouble.

Pedestrians are also affected by this.

The road is narrow, as vehicles are often parked on both sides of it. So, pedestrians have to walk in the carriageway, an motorists swerve around the manhole, there is the likelihood of the former being knocked down.

The stretch provides access to six educational institutions in Srinivasapuram and Kottivakkam.

A CMWSSB official has promised to do the needful at the earliest.
